Fur gets everywhere. It gets trapped in the cushions, coils around seams, and seems like it will last longer than your greatest vacuum. Australian Labradoodles, Staffies, or even sleek cats don’t mind, and neither do their hair. Here’s something you should know: typical household vacuums can only get rid of about 60% of pet hair on furniture. The rest is stuck behind by static.
Now put some wax on your surfboard. If you leave it too close to the living room, it can slip into the armrests and make the fibers cluster together. You’re in trouble if you rub it. Over time, surf wax hardens, collects lint, and leaves stains that soap and water can’t get rid of.
The bad guy is the sunscreen. Everyone who lives on the Northern Beaches knows that sunscreen produces an oily film that protects skin but also collects dirt and dust. It gets into cushions and leaves behind shiny spots and black, greasy stains that most DIY cleaners can’t get rid of.
The good news is? Professionals who clean upholstery know how to do it well. Vibrating brushes that dry and pull thick fur. When you set the steam to the right temperature, the surf wax becomes soft enough to be safely and carefully taken off. Eco-friendly solvents break down the oily molecules in sun cream without fading the textile or making your house smell like a chemical factory.
